Running an eCommerce business can be highly profitable, but many store owners unknowingly make mistakes that hurt their growth. If you want to scale successfully, avoiding these common pitfalls is key.
In this post, we’ll cover the top 10 mistakes eCommerce owners make and how to fix them for long-term success.
🚨 1. Poor Website User Experience (UX)
Mistake: A slow, cluttered, or confusing website that frustrates visitors and leads to high bounce rates.
How to Avoid:
- Optimize site speed (Use CDNs like CloudFront, compress images, and enable caching)
- Ensure mobile responsiveness
- Use clear navigation and a frictionless checkout process
Tool Suggestions: Google PageSpeed Insights, GTmetrix
📉 2. Ignoring SEO (Search Engine Optimization)
Mistake: Not optimizing product pages, categories, and blogs for search engines.
How to Avoid:
- Conduct keyword research (Use SEMrush, Ahrefs, or Google Keyword Planner)
- Optimize product descriptions, meta titles, and image alt text
- Implement structured data (schema markup) to improve search visibility
Tool Suggestions: SEMrush, Ahrefs, Screaming Frog
💳 3. Complicated Checkout Process
Mistake: A long or confusing checkout process that causes cart abandonment.
How to Avoid:
- Offer guest checkout
- Reduce form fields to essentials
- Provide multiple payment options (PayPal, Stripe, Apple Pay, BNPL options)
Tool Suggestions: Shopify Checkout, WooCommerce Checkout Plugins
🔄 4. Not Using Email Marketing & Retargeting
Mistake: Not capturing leads or following up with potential customers.
How to Avoid:
- Set up abandoned cart emails
- Use Klaviyo or Mailchimp for automated customer retention emails
- Implement retargeting ads on Google and Meta
Tool Suggestions: Klaviyo, Mailchimp, Meta Pixel
📦 5. Poor Inventory & Order Management
Mistake: Overselling or running out of stock due to poor inventory tracking.
How to Avoid:
- Use inventory management software (NetSuite, TradeGecko, or Zoho Inventory)
- Automate stock updates with WooCommerce, Shopify, or Adobe Commerce
- Sync inventory across multiple sales channels
Tool Suggestions: NetSuite, TradeGecko, WooCommerce Inventory Manager
🎯 6. Not Understanding Customer Data & Analytics
Mistake: Making business decisions without analyzing data.
How to Avoid:
- Use Google Analytics 4 (GA4) to track traffic and conversions
- Analyze customer behavior and optimize based on insights
- Leverage heatmaps to see how users interact with your site
Tool Suggestions: Google Analytics, Hotjar, Crazy Egg
📱 7. Ignoring Mobile Optimization
Mistake: Failing to optimize the store for mobile shoppers.
How to Avoid:
- Ensure mobile-friendly design and responsive themes
- Simplify the checkout process for mobile users
- Implement Google AMP for faster mobile load times
Tool Suggestions: Google Mobile-Friendly Test, AMP Validator
💰 8. Poor Pricing & Discounts Strategy
Mistake: Overpricing, underpricing, or offering discounts that kill margins.
How to Avoid:
- Conduct competitor analysis before setting prices
- Use psychological pricing strategies (e.g., $9.99 instead of $10.00)
- Avoid excessive discounts that reduce profit margins
Tool Suggestions: Price Intelligently, Prisync
📣 9. Weak Social Media & Paid Ads Strategy
Mistake: Running ads without a strategy or failing to engage on social media.
How to Avoid:
- Use retargeting ads and lookalike audiences on Meta and Google Ads
- Post consistently on social media and engage with followers
- Test different ad creatives and optimize based on data
Tool Suggestions: Meta Ads Manager, Google Ads, Hootsuite, Buffer
⏳ 10. Expecting Overnight Success
Mistake: Believing an eCommerce business will be profitable instantly.
How to Avoid:
- Set realistic expectations and plan for long-term growth
- Continuously optimize based on performance and customer feedback
- Stay updated with eCommerce trends and algorithm changes
